5338 HEATHERLAND CT ELLICOTT CITY, MD 21043 Get Directions
5338 HEATHERLAND CT ELLICOTT CITY, MD 21043 Get Directions
Millennium Oaks Institute was founded in 2010, and is located at 5338 Heatherland Ct in Ellicott City. Additional information is available at or by contacting Charles Atkinson at (410) 418-5434.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.